To achieve automatic cancellation of pending orders at a specific time every day, a Script is technically insufficient because a script runs once and terminates. Instead, you need an Expert Advisor (EA). An EA runs continuously on the chart and can monitor the time to execute the cancellation logic daily.
Below is the complete MQL4 code for an Expert Advisor that performs this task.

Note: This is Broker Server Time, which you can see in the "Market Watch" window.Q: Why use an Expert Advisor instead of a Script?
A: A Script executes its code once and then removes itself from the chart. To run "automatically at the end of each day," the program must remain active on the chart to monitor the time continuously. Only an Expert Advisor can do this.
Q: Will this close my active (open) trades?
A: No. The code specifically checks if(OrderType() > OP_SELL). Active market orders are type 0 (Buy) or 1 (Sell). Pending orders are types 2 through 5. This logic ensures only pending orders are deleted.
Q: What happens if I restart my computer?
A: The variable LastCancellationTime resets to 0. If you restart the computer after the designated time has passed for the day, the EA will see that the time condition is met and the "Day of Year" check differs, so it will run the cancellation immediately upon restart. If you restart before the time, it will wait for the time as usual.
Q: Does this work for all symbols?
A: Yes, by default. If you want it to only work for the specific chart you attach it to, change the input InpOnlyCurrentSymbol to true.
